Transaction 24b156fd4b3ce987fa82f4113ca23cde8807c1abbd55f06ea0428145de16ef9e
1 Input
1 Output
-
24b156fd4b3ce987fa82f4113ca23cde8807c1abbd55f06ea0428145de16ef9e:0
- value
- 12063
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23270ccfa61b24504239f278380ed06d5310f90c OP_EQUAL
- address
- 34ttMW6Lw9yC7byYXDu6mP2XWJzNcsycap